  • Carbon dioxide increases in 2007
    AP ( 20, 2008)
    WASHINGTOIN (AP) - The Energy Department reports that carbon dioxide emissions increased by 1.6 percent last year with most coming from residential and commercial energy use. Emissions from transportation and industrial sources were essentially flat, compared to 2006.
     
  • Audit: FBI didn't join harsh terror interrogations
    AP ( 20, 2008)
    WASHINGTON (AP) - A Justice Department audit of terror interrogations at three military bases overseas concluded Tuesday that FBI agents refused to participate when detainees were questioned under harsh and potentially illegal methods.
     
  • Oil crosses $129 for first time, heads for $130
    AP ( 20, 2008)
    NEW YORK (AP) - Oil prices spiked to a new trading high Tuesday, sweeping toward $130 a barrel as supply concerns intensified the momentum buying that has lifted crude deeper into record territory.
     
  • US: Myanmar's storm response appalling
    AP ( 20, 2008)
    WASHINGTON (AP) - A senior U.S. diplomat said Tuesday that Myanmar's military-led government will be responsible for a second catastrophe if thousands of desperate cyclone survivors die because the junta continues to bar foreign aid and disaster workers.
